Because of this particular 'season' in my friend's life, I've been thinking and meditating on Ecclesiastes 3:1-8.


"For everything there is a season,
    a time for every activity under heaven.
A time to be born and a time to die.
    A time to plant and a time to harvest.
A time to kill and a time to heal.
    A time to tear down and a time to build up.
A time to cry and a time to laugh.
    A time to grieve and a time to dance.
A time to scatter stones and a time to gather stones.
    A time to embrace and a time to turn away.
A time to search and a time to quit searching.
    A time to keep and a time to throw away.
A time to tear and a time to mend.
    A time to be quiet and a time to speak.
A time to love and a time to hate.
    A time for war and a time for peace."

We all have seasons in our life. Those seasons are normal. There is an appointed time for everything that we go through. No one likes to deal with the death of a loved one...but it is a season...for us and for the departed one. Should the Lord tarry, we will all experience that season.  

For each positive season, there is a negative one. A time to be born (positive) and a time to die (negative). A time to kill (negative) and a time to heal (positive). You get my drift. So, my friend, if you are currently in a positive season, enjoy it, embrace it because as sure as the sun will rise tomorrow a negative season will come. But remember this...when the negative season does come, a positive time will follow.

See it's a cycle...you won't get stuck in a negative season...positive will come. Don't get discouraged in the negative. Just remember...there is a time for every activity under heaven.
